Bastian Steger (born 19 March 1981) is a German table tennis player. He competed for Germany at the 2012 Summer Olympics where he won a bronze medal in the team event. [1] He also won the bronze medal in the men's team event during the 2016 Summer Olympics in Rio de Janeiro. [2] [3]
